When Jesus taught about coming unto him in this world he spoke of being born again. So yes, in the context that you speak of, we need to be born again of the spirit through baptism and receiving the Holy Ghost to be numbered among those on this earth who are his. But the birth I speak of occurred before the foundation of this earth and at that time were were all born as the spirit children of our Father in heaven.
God the Father is the father of our spirits.
Hebrews 12:9
9 Furthermore we have had fathers of our flesh which corrected us, and we gave them
reverence: shall we not much rather be in subjection unto the Father of spirits, and live?
Paul taught that we are the literal offspring of the Father:
Acts:17:29
29 Forasmuch then as we are the offspring of God, we ought not to think that the Godhead is like unto gold, or silver, or stone, graven by art and man’s device.
Because our spirits are the literal offspring of God, mankind was created in his very image and likeness.
Psalms 82:6 tells us that we are all children of the Most High and for this reason we are gods.
Psalms 82:6
6 I have said, Ye are gods; and all of you are children of the most High.
Before the foundation of this earth while it was being laid, all the sons of God shouted for joy.
Job 38:3-7
3 Gird up now thy loins like a man; for I will demand of thee, and answer thou me.
4 Where wast thou when I laid the foundations of the earth? declare, if thou hast understanding.
5 Who hath laid the measures thereof, if thou knowest? or who hath stretched the line upon it?
6 Whereupon are the foundations thereof fastened? or who laid the corner stone thereof;
7 When the morning stars sang together, and all the sons of God shouted for joy?
True that after experiencing the fall, we needed to be born again and be renewed as sons and daughters of Jesus Christ in the gospel. But before the foundation of this earth we were all the spirit children of God the Father and Jesus Christ was the first born among many brethren. Speaking of the premortal existence Paul teaches us:
Romans 8:
29 For whom he did foreknow, he also did predestinate to be conformed to the image of his Son, that he might be the firstborn among many brethren.
